    ComPara: A Corpus Linguistics Dataset of Computation in Architecture

    No full text
    A corpus linguistics built to study the language of computational architecture, or architecture which focuses on technology developments. The corpus includes: (1) the volume titles, titles of articles and introduction keywords for the journal Architectural Design (AD) to retrieve keynotes in theoretical discourse, and (2) titles and abstracts of winning and honourable mentions of the eVolo Skyscraper competition to retrieve words in conceptual project titles and their descriptions. This dataset has around 100.000 words and can serve as a basis for quantitative, qualitative or mixed method analysis of the language used in AD and the eVolo skyscraper competition between 2005 and 2019. As AD is recognized as one of the journals focusing on the 'digital turns' in architecture, and eVolo is a the most prestigious architectural competitions which focus on technological advances in architetcure, ComPara can be considered respresentative for the language of computational architecture over the last 15 years. It includes .txt and .csv files as well as .svg and wordclouds

    Annotated point clouds of buildings: a segmented dataset of single-family houses

    No full text
    The dataset contains 2.904 geometries of single-family houses in the form of annotated Point Clouds, and was developed in order to train 3D Generative Adversarial Networks. The geometries are segmented within 3 classes: wall, roof, floor. The points of the point clouds are saved in .pts files while their labels are saved in .seg files. The creation of the dataset was done in a semi-automated way that consists of two stages: a) creation of module geometries representing building components (done in Rhino3D) b) the conversion of the geometries into Point Clouds with the Cockroach plug-in. 25 wall modules and 35 roof modules were created. Each wall module was combined with each roof module. Data augmentation methods were applied to maximize the size of the dataset: the modules were scaled in 3 ranges, and rotated 90 degrees for a wider feature space. The dataset can be used to train 3D GANs with architecturally relevant data. Connected publication describing a use case of this dataset to follow
